What Mullvad extension chrome is and how it fits into your privacy toolkit
- Mullvad extension chrome is a browser-level interface that connects Chrome traffic to Mullvad’s VPN network. It works in tandem with the Mullvad desktop app or an existing Mullvad account to route browser traffic through Mullvad’s servers.
- The extension is designed for users who want quick control over which traffic goes through Mullvad when they’re in a Chrome-based workflow, without necessarily routing every device-wide connection through the VPN.
- Key value: it gives you the ability to switch servers, enable or disable the VPN with a click, and check your current IP address from within the browser.

Performance considerations: speed, latency, and server coverage
- Server coverage: Mullvad has a broad network of servers across many regions, which helps with geolocation options and redundancy. Availability for Chrome users depends on server load and routing from your location.
- Speed and latency: In many cases Mullvad’s use of modern protocols including WireGuard provides solid speeds for everyday browsing and HD streaming. Real-world performance will vary by your baseline internet plan, distance to the server, and the current load on the Mullvad network.
- Stability: The Chrome extension is designed to give you a stable toggle and server selection. If you notice drops in speed or connection stability, experimenting with a nearby server or switching from UDP to TCP where available can help.
How to install Mullvad extension chrome step-by-step
- Prepare your Mullvad account
- If you don’t have a Mullvad account, visit Mullvad’s official site and create a new account. You’ll receive an account number that you’ll use in the extension. This is part of Mullvad’s privacy-focused model where accounts aren’t tied to personal information.
- Open Chrome and go to the Mullvad extension page
- Search for “Mullvad extension chrome” in the Chrome Web Store, or visit Mullvad’s official site for the extension download link.
- Install the extension
- Click “Add to Chrome” and confirm. The extension should appear in your browser’s extension bar.
- Sign in with your Mullvad account
- Open the extension, paste your Mullvad account number or follow the on-screen prompts to log in, and grant the minimal permissions needed for the extension to operate.
- Choose a server and connect
- In the extension UI, pick a server region, then click Connect. The extension will establish a tunnel through Mullvad’s network for your browser traffic.
- Verify the connection
- After connecting, check your IP address using an in-extension status or by visiting a site that shows your public IP. Ensure it reflects your Mullvad server location and not your actual location.
- Optional: configure privacy protections
- If available, enable features like DNS protection or a browser-level kill switch that blocks traffic if the VPN disconnects. This helps prevent accidental leaks while browsing.

Security considerations and best practices
- Always pair the extension with strong on-device security: keep Chrome up to date, review extension permissions, and avoid installing unnecessary add-ons that could collect data.
- Use the kill switch or traffic-inspection features if the extension offers them to prevent leaks when the VPN connection drops.
- Be mindful of WebRTC leaks in browsers. While the extension can help, you may also want to disable or protect WebRTC in Chrome for extra privacy.
- If you rely on Mullvad for sensitive tasks, consider using the full device VPN Mullvad desktop app in addition to the browser extension to ensure the entire device’s traffic is protected.
Common issues and quick fixes
- Issue: The extension won’t connect
- Fix: Verify your Mullvad account status, re-enter your account number, restart Chrome, and try a different server location. If you see a persistent failure, ensure you’re not blocking VPN-related endpoints with firewall rules.
- Issue: DNS leaks detected
- Fix: Enable DNS protection in the extension and ensure the desktop app if used is also configured for DNS leak protection. Consider flushing DNS after connecting to Mullvad.
- Issue: Slow speeds
- Fix: Switch to a nearby server or try a different protocol/port if available. Close other bandwidth-heavy applications and ensure your local network isn’t congested.
- Issue: Browser extensions conflict
- Fix: Disable other VPN-related or security extensions temporarily to identify conflicts. Re-enable them one by one to find the culprit.
- Issue: Chrome on some devices Chrome OS
- Fix: Ensure the extension is up to date and Chrome OS permissions haven’t changed. If issues persist, reboot the device and re-install the extension.

Pricing and plans overview
- Mullvad uses a straightforward pricing model focused on simplicity and privacy. It generally charges a flat monthly rate historically around €5 per month for access to the VPN network, with the ability to pay anonymously for example, via cash or cryptocurrency in certain regions and without requiring personal information to create an account.
- There are no restrictive contracts or long-term commitments. You can pause or cancel by simply not renewing your account, depending on Mullvad’s current policy.
- The browser extension access is included as part of your Mullvad service, and there are no separate subscription fees for the extension itself.
